Output 3e8fc9706844a0c63ea1dde64312452f409897cfecd02321ade73600ea56684f:18

value
27669000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523525cf9a381ec24b88ff7869dca69fad1996a6 OP_EQUAL
address
39Bh13KDTx1xLy1Wm6RaNCQYkkAoyqrYe8
transaction
3e8fc9706844a0c63ea1dde64312452f409897cfecd02321ade73600ea56684f
confirmations
242955
spent
true